机器之心:嵌入式技术的边界
一、探索边界
在当今这个信息爆炸和科技飞速发展的时代,计算机与自动化这两个领域正迅速向着交叉点迈进。其中,嵌入式技术作为它们之间不可或缺的一环,让我们不得不思考一个问题:嵌入式到底属于计算机还是自动化?
二、定义与区分
首先,我们需要对“计算机”和“自动化”进行定义。计算机是指能够执行指令并存储数据的电子设备,而自动化则是指通过机械手段或电气控制系统实现的人工智能。
三、嵌入式技术简介
嵌入式系统是一种专为特定应用环境设计的实时操作系统,它通常集成在硬件设备中,如智能家居设备、中小型工业控制器等。在这些设备中,微处理器承担了执行任务和管理数据流动的角色。
四、编程语言与软件开发
为了让这些微处理器能够有效地工作,我们需要使用特定的编程语言来编写程序,这些程序将被转换成可以直接运行于硬件上的代码。这就使得嵌入式系统既包含了计算机(即CPU)的运算能力,也包括了自动化(即通过预设规则完成复杂任务)的元素。
五、跨领域融合
随着时间的推移,嵌入式技术越来越多地融合了两者的优势。例如,在汽车工业中,现代车辆中的驾驶辅助系统就是通过高级嵌入式软件实现,其中包含了复杂的算法来帮助司机避免事故,同时也依赖于强大的CPU处理能力以确保实时响应。
六、未来趋势
随着物联网(IoT)技术的大规模应用,以及人工智能(AI)和大数据分析(DA)相结合带来的新变化,我们可以预见到未来的所有电子产品都会更加智能、高效,并且会进一步缩短“计算机”和“自动化”的界限。此时,不再仅仅讨论哪个领域更重要,而是在于如何更好地结合两者,以满足日益增长的人类需求。
七、大结语
总而言之,无论从历史发展还是现实应用出发,都难以简单划分出明确答案——"是否应该把某个具体类型的事物归为'X'或者'Y'"。因为实际上,大部分事物都具有多重属性,而且它们不断演变,其边界也随之改变。而我们的关注点应当放在如何利用这一切提升我们的生活质量以及解决更多复杂问题上,而不是只追求划清一二权利之争。